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ple First Messages That Work

Feeling stuck on what to say is normal. Start with low-pressure, adaptable openers that invite a short reply and let the conversation grow naturally.

Opener Patterns You Can Customize

  • Profile hook + quick question: Comment on a specific detail from their profile or photo, then add an easy question. Example: "Nice hiking photo—what trail is that?" or "You mentioned cooking—what's your go-to weeknight meal?"
  • Shared interest flip: If you both like a band, book, or hobby, offer a specific angle. Example: "I see you like [band]—which song should I start with?"
  • Two-choice prompt: Offer two simple options to lower the decision bar. Example: "Coffee or tea? Beach day or city walk?"
  • Light observation + playful invite: Make a friendly observation and invite a small story. Example: "That vintage jacket has character—what's the story behind it?"

Keep It Natural, Not Forced

  • Skip clichés and generic lines like "Hey" or "What's up?" They leave too much work for the other person.
  • Avoid heavy compliments or overly intimate questions in the first message—save deeper topics until you know each other a bit.
  • Use the person's profile to find real hooks. Even a small detail (a pet, a hobby, a band tee) is better than a copy-paste opener.

Small Details That Make Messages Better

  • Use their name or a detail: It shows you read their profile and makes your message feel personal.
  • Keep it short: One or two sentences works. Aim to spark a reply, not tell your life story.
  • Ask an easy, answerable question: Questions that can be answered in a few words have higher response rates.
  • Mirror tone: If their profile is playful, match that energy; if it's straightforward, be clear and polite.

Quick Templates To Modify

  1. Profile hook + question: "I noticed you [detail]—how did you get into that?"
  2. Shared interest starter: "You like [interest]—any recommendations for someone who wants to try it?"
  3. Two-choice prompt: "Which would you pick: [option A] or [option B]?"
  4. Fun micro-challenge: "Help settle a debate: pineapple on pizza—yes or no?"

When A Conversation Stalls

  • Bring up a new, lightweight topic tied to something in their profile or your previous exchange.
  • Use a callback: reference a small thing they said earlier to show you were listening (for example, "You mentioned salsa class—how was last week?").
  • If replies dry up, give it time or send one simple, upbeat follow-up—no pressure and no guilt.
